a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orWofWca <wofwca@protonmail.com>2023-01-12 08:54:59 +0000
committeritchyonion <itchyonion@torproject.org>2023-02-09 11:45:09 -0800
commit5cc849e186a7b5f5cac238e3497a64bd46ac0a29 (patch)
treeeb9386b444f7d41739e59ee316b02b519c49b0ed
parent990fcb41274f8d983c23b035636a22e4491290d8 (diff)
downloadsnowflake-5cc849e186a7b5f5cac238e3497a64bd46ac0a29.tar.gz
snowflake-5cc849e186a7b5f5cac238e3497a64bd46ac0a29.zip
fix: up/down traffic stats being mixed up
-rw-r--r--proxy/lib/pt_event_logger.go2
-rw-r--r--proxy/lib/util.go2
2 files changed, 2 insertions, 2 deletions
diff --git a/proxy/lib/pt_event_logger.go b/proxy/lib/pt_event_logger.go
index ce89545..745437b 100644
--- a/proxy/lib/pt_event_logger.go
+++ b/proxy/lib/pt_event_logger.go
@@ -41,7 +41,7 @@ func (p *logEventLogger) OnNewSnowflakeEvent(e event.SnowflakeEvent) {
func (p *logEventLogger) logTick() error {
inbound, inboundUnit := formatTraffic(p.inboundSum)
outbound, outboundUnit := formatTraffic(p.outboundSum)
- p.logger.Printf("In the last %v, there were %v connections. Traffic Relayed ↑ %v %v, ↓ %v %v.\n",
+ p.logger.Printf("In the last %v, there were %v connections. Traffic Relayed ↓ %v %v, ↑ %v %v.\n",
p.logPeriod.String(), p.connectionCount, inbound, inboundUnit, outbound, outboundUnit)
p.outboundSum = 0
p.inboundSum = 0
diff --git a/proxy/lib/util.go b/proxy/lib/util.go
index 0bbe588..dd8681e 100644
--- a/proxy/lib/util.go
+++ b/proxy/lib/util.go
@@ -80,7 +80,7 @@ func (b *bytesSyncLogger) ThroughputSummary() string {
outbound, outUnit := formatTraffic(outbound)
t := time.Now()
- return fmt.Sprintf("Traffic throughput (up|down): %d %s|%d %s -- (%d OnMessages, %d Sends, over %d seconds)", inbound, inUnit, outbound, outUnit, b.outEvents, b.inEvents, int(t.Sub(b.start).Seconds()))
+ return fmt.Sprintf("Traffic throughput (down|up): %d %s|%d %s -- (%d OnMessages, %d Sends, over %d seconds)", inbound, inUnit, outbound, outUnit, b.outEvents, b.inEvents, int(t.Sub(b.start).Seconds()))
}
func (b *bytesSyncLogger) GetStat() (in int64, out int64) { return b.inbound, b.outbound }